Muraltia saxicola
Muraltia saxicola is a perennial ornamental plant that grows 0.2–0.4 meters tall and is evergreen. It thrives in full sun and requires medium watering, suitable for USDA zones 6–8. The plant blooms for an extended period from spring through fall with pink and purple flowers. It prefers sandy, loamy, or chalky soil and attracts pollinators.
